Clinical overview
The Humeral Shaft External Fixator is a modular, Hoffman-type system designed for the management of complex humeral shaft fractures, including open fractures, comminuted injuries, and cases requiring temporary or definitive stabilisation. The system provides rigid fixation through a combination of percutaneous pins and connecting rods, allowing early mobilisation and reducing complications associated with prolonged immobilisation.
The complete kit includes all necessary coupling mechanisms, clamps, and fixation elements, enabling surgeons to configure the frame according to fracture pattern and patient anatomy. Self-drilling apex pins ensure secure cortical purchase, while the modular rod-rod and rod-pin couplings provide flexibility in frame design and adjustment during the healing process.

Technical specifications
| Indications | Humeral shaft fractures, proximal and mid-shaft trauma, open fractures, comminuted injuries |
|---|---|
| Sizes / range | 3/4mm pins, 5mm rods (250mm and 200mm lengths), 4×120mm apex pins |
| Material | Aluminum connecting rods, stainless steel couplings and clamps, self-drilling steel apex pins |
| Sterilisation | Autoclavable (121°C, 15 minutes at 15 psi) |
| Packaging | Complete system kit in sterile, reusable instrument tray |
| Warranty | 2 Year Manufacturer Warranty |
Standard instrument composition
| Item | Description | Qty |
|---|---|---|
| 7100-1001 | Rod-Rod Coupling (5mm Rod) | 4 |
| 7100-1002 | Rod-Pin Coupling (3/4mm Pin, 5mm Rod) | 2 |
| 7100-1003 | 4-Hole Pin Clamp (3/4mm Pin) | 1 |
| 7100-1004 | Aluminum Connecting Rod 5×250mm | 2 |
| 7100-1005 | Aluminum Connecting Rod 5×200mm | 1 |
| 7100-1006 | Post 5mm/30 Degree | 2 |
| 7100-1007 | Apex Pin Self-drilling 4×120mm | 4 |
